Orangetheory Fitness is heart rate zone training that delivers a full body group workout.

Orangetheory Fitness in Omaha, NE offers heart rate zone training that delivers a smarter way to work out. Experience an expertly designed, full-body group workout combining cardio and strength training with real-time tracking for measurable results you can see and feel. Here in Omaha, your heart rate sets the pace, enabling our triple-certified coaches to get you into the optimal zone. The result is a personalized fitness experience tailored to your fitness level.

Orangetheory Fitness: 2026 USA TODAY 10BEST Readers' Choice Awards Orangetheory Fitness blends total-body strength and cardio in every class to help members burn fat and build muscle. Using a combination of weight floor, treadmill, and rower, each workout is coach-led to maximize results and feel approachable for all fitness levels.
